When choosing a budget KitchenAid stand mixer, consider the size of your typical batches, the power needed for your recipes, and the ease of use. A mixer with a sturdy metal construction and multiple speed settings will provide durability and versatility. Also, verify compatibility with attachments and accessories to expand your kitchen capabilities without extra costs.

For beginners or those with limited space, a 4.5-quart model offers a compact yet capable option. If you want a balance between affordability and quality, the 5-quart models provide more capacity and features. Don’t forget to check for dishwasher-safe parts and available colors to match your kitchen style.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are budget KitchenAid mixers durable?
Yes, models like the Classic Series and Artisan Series are built with metal construction, ensuring durability for everyday baking tasks.
Can I use attachments with these budget mixers?
Many budget models support a range of attachments, but always verify compatibility, especially with the stainless steel paddle, which fits most 4.5-5 quart mixers.
What size mixer should I choose?
A 4.5-quart mixer is suitable for smaller households and light baking, while a 5-quart mixer offers more capacity for larger batches and more versatility.
Is a tilt-head mixer better?
Tilt-head models provide easier access to the bowl, making adding ingredients and cleaning more convenient, especially for beginner bakers.
